The A290-7007-X310 limit switch plate by FANUC is designed for precision and reliability in diverse industrial settings. This component supports an array of applications, encompassing commodity production, advanced machining, and CNC milling tasks. It can operate efficiently in a controlled environment characterized by temperatures from 0 to 40 degrees Celsius, making it viable for various setups. Similarly, the device remains operational at altitudes reaching up to 1000 meters above sea level.
In terms of environmental conditions, both operating and storage scenarios allow for humidity levels to peak at 80% without condensation present, ensuring that the functionality remains unaffected in high-humidity conditions. When considering storage, the unit is adaptable to a wider temperature gradient of 0 to 50 degrees Celsius without compromising integrity. To guarantee optimal performance, the switch plate is recommended for use in situations devoid of corrosive chemicals, ensuring longevity and reliability across applications.
